LED aviation obstruction beacon
Technical field
The utility model belongs to luminaire for air traffic technical field, particularly a kind of LED aviation obstruction beacon.
Background technology
At present, by national standard, the skyscraper that top exceeds more than 45 meters, its ground must arrange navigation light.In order to distinguish to some extent with general purpose illuminating lamp, navigation light is not long light yellow but glittering, and flashing rate is not less than 20 times per minute, not higher than 70 times per minute.Barrier should go out the peak of barrier and aviation obstruction beacon is established at most edge by mark with regard to the setting of its obstruction light, and the spacing in intermediate layer must be not more than 45 meters, and in city, more than hundred meters super-high buildings things especially will consider that intermediate layer adds aviation obstruction beacon.Aviation obstruction beacon is generally divided into low light intensity, middle light intensity and high light intensity three kinds.Overhead more than 90 meters is red flashing light lamp less than light intensity navigation obstacle lamp in 150 meters of buildings and facility use thereof, flashing rate should between 20 ~ 60 times per minute, the efficient intensity of flash of light is not less than 1600cd or uses red high light intensity obstruction light, makes its flash effect more obvious; Overhead more than 150 meters buildings and facility thereof, uses high light intensity obstruction light and is necessary for white flash lamp, and flashing rate should between 20 ~ 70 times per minute, and efficient intensity is fixed with background luminance.No matter which kind of aviation obstruction beacon, its aviation obstruction beacon number at differing heights and arrangement, should be able to can find out this object or object " group's profile " in all its bearings, and glimmer while considering obstruction light and sequentially, to reach obvious warning function.Along with the rising of population density, building gets more and more, the profile that its top then needs a large amount of aviation obstruction beacons to glimmer to show building in night simultaneously, and existing aviation obstruction beacon, lampshade plane of refraction is little, and service life is short, need often to safeguard, and power consumption is large energy-conservation not.

Detailed description of the invention
For the benefit of to the understanding of structure of the present invention, be described below in conjunction with drawings and Examples.
Fig. 1 is the explosive view of the utility model LED aviation obstruction beacon, and Fig. 2 is the structural representation that the utility model LED aviation obstruction beacon opens lampshade, and Fig. 3 is the structural representation of the utility model LED aviation obstruction beacon.
Shown in composition graphs 1 to Fig. 3, the utility model provides a kind of LED aviation obstruction beacon, comprising: lamp housing 10, LED drive unit 20, radiator 30, LED light source unit 40 and lampshade assembly 50.
Lamp housing 10, is formed with accommodation space and the construction opening being communicated in described accommodation space.Described lamp housing comprises: columned lamp body 11 and the ring-type turnover panel 13 radially extended along lamp body construction opening.Further, plug 12 is provided with in the bottom of described lamp body.
Plug 12 is electric interfaces of LED aviation obstruction beacon, and it is fastened on the bottom of lamp body 10.
LED drive unit 20, concrete example is as being LED driver, be seated in the accommodation space of described lamp housing 10, be fixed by screw the inner chamber at lamp body 11, its function is direct current external communication electricity being converted into driving LED light source, and provides control signal to carry out the function such as light modulation, fault detect to reach to light fixture.This driver element 20 top connects LED light source unit by wire, and the installation position leaving electric interfaces bottom driver element, with attachment plug, is passed by wire and is connected to power supply.
LED light source unit 40, described LED light source unit 40 is located on the construction opening of lamp housing 10, comprises light source circuit board 41 and is located at the multiple LED light sources 42 on described light source circuit board.The size of light source circuit board 41 corresponding lamp housing 10 internal diameter is arranged, and in disc-shaped, is provided with a plug wire hole 43 in the center of light source circuit board.In the present embodiment, LED light source 42 is high-power LED light source, and the number of LED light source 42 is 4,4 LED light sources 42 evenly enclose and the week being welded on light source circuit board 41 along upper.
Fin 30, adheres to described light source circuit board 41 back and setting of fitting, and in the present embodiment, is preferably aluminium sheet.This aluminium sheet has good heat conductivility, the heat produced can be derived rapidly during LED light source 42 luminescence.And aluminium sheet offers cable hole, the wire picked out for LED drive unit 20 connects LED light source unit 40.
Lampshade assembly 50, the end of described lamp housing construction opening is located at by described lampshade assembly, and described lampshade assembly comprises transparent cover 51 and the retainer ring 52 for fixing transparent cover 51.In the present embodiment, retainer ring 52 and transparent cover 51 are discrete setting.
Transparent cover 51, extends towards lamp housing 10 outer lug, and described transparent cover 51 cylinder cover at the bottom of in an arc, prompting light can be reflected away from more direction, strengthen alarming effect.
Retainer ring 52, in circular, corresponding with ring-type turnover panel 13 size and fit and arrange, be also provided with a water proof ring in retainer ring 52, and retainer ring 52 and ring-type turnover panel 13 are screwed together.Further, between retainer ring 52 and the construction opening of lamp housing 10, be provided with a circle grafting pilot hole, fix for transparent cover 51 grafting.

Now the assembling detail of the LED aviation obstruction beacon that the utility model provides is described in detail.
First, driver 20 is fixed in the accommodation space of lamp housing 10 inside, then in the bottom of lamp body, electric plug receptacle 13 is installed, further, fin 30 is mounted on the construction opening of lamp housing 10, by the wire on driver 20 top through for subsequent use after the cable hole of fin 30, then LED light source unit 40 is installed, wire is solidly connected on LED light source circuit board 40, selects the red LED light source of 1.5W to be evenly laid in the week of LED light source circuit board along upper.Further, transparent cover 51 in lampshade assembly is slightly done to extend, adds range of refractive, the people of surrounding can be made more easily to find this warning lamp, finally, retainer ring 52 is connected with the corresponding bolt of ring-type turnover panel 13 of lamp housing 10, has namely assembled.
